Transaction 5e90af8b24da716e9bec64d65e0a927349b98f6d73526e48d42dfc258908c67f
1 Input
1 Output
-
5e90af8b24da716e9bec64d65e0a927349b98f6d73526e48d42dfc258908c67f:0
- value
- 3851685
- script pubkey
- OP_0 OP_PUSHBYTES_20 07d8dc958a9f9b3bb94198f2f8e4f90047384f62
- address
- bc1qqlvde9v2n7dnhw2pnre03e8eqprnsnmzryevvl